Sometimes an idea makes so much sense and is so useful that it can only be described as genius. Here are 3 that inarguably fall into that category.
Calendly – the ubiquitous scheduling tool that no busy executive or business development professional can live without. Letting someone put time on your calendar during blocks that you designate saves a dozen back-and-forth emails, and the time and frustration that can accompany trying to coordinate calendars.
Scholly – A search engine for college scholarships that has helped students win more than $100 million by simplifying and consolidating the search for available opportunities. After founder Christopher Gray spent 7 months researching and applying for his own scholarships, he utilized the vast knowledge that he acquired to streamline the process for others.
EcoText – this startup has a mission that focuses on education, economy and environment. Working with textbook publishers to offer digital textbooks that can be purchased in sections or their entirety reduces the eye-watering cost of printed books and saves them from ending up in a landfill.
